drm/i915/dsb: single register write function for DSB.
DSB support single register write through opcode 0x1. Generic api created which accumulate all single register write in a batch buffer and once DSB is triggered, it will program all the registers at the same time. v1: Initial version. v2: Unused macro removed and cosmetic changes done.
